Многостоповый преобразователь временных интервалов в цифровой код

Иллюстрации

Показать все

Реферат

 

Союз Советских

Социалистических

Респубпии

ОПИСАНИЕ

ИЗОБРЕТЕН ИЯ

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(61) Дополнительное к авт. свид-ву (22} Заявлено 30.07.79(21) 280816 1/18-2 1 с присоединением заявки JO (23) Приоритет

Опубликовано 15. 08.81. Бнмлетеиь .% 30 (5()М. Кл.

Н 03 К 13/20

6 04 F 10/04

Гааудерстввиный комитет

СССР йо девая изобретений и открытий 53} УДК 681. . 325 (088,8) Дата опубликования описания 15.08.81 (72) Авторы изобретения

B. В. Марченков и Ю. В. Тубольцев (71) Заявитель Ленинградский институт ядерной физики им. Б. П. Константинова (54 ) МНОГОСТОПОВЫ Й ПРЕОБРА ЗОВА ТЕЛЬ

ВРЕМЕННЫХ ИНТЕРВАЛОВ В ЦИФРОВОЙ КОД

Изобретение относится к экспериментальной ядерной физике, в частности к временным спектрометрам, и может быть грименено в нейтронных спектрометрах, использующих вр емя-пропетную методику.

Известен многостоповый преобразова5 тель временных интервалов в щ@ровой код последовательного действия, содержаший счетчик времени, генератор тактовых импульсов, погику управления и запоминающее устройство Pl).

Недостаток такого преобразователяналичие мертвого времени, когда точность измерений соизмерима с быстродействием элементной базы, что приводит к искажению временного спектра.

Наиболее близким по технической сущности к предлагаемому является много стоповый преобразователь временных интервалов в цифровой код параллельного действия, содержащий четыре счетчика, генератор тактовых импульсов, таймер, сдвиговый регистр, выполненный на четырех триггерах и четыре логических элемента И с двумя входами. Вход таймера соединен со входом установки в единичное состояние сдвигового регистра. Первые входы логических элементов H. объединены между собой и соединены с выходом генератора тактовых . импульсов, вторые входы логических элементов И соединены с соответствуюшими выходами сдвигового регистра, а выходы логических элементов И подключены к соответствукнпим входам счетчиков.

Момент начала формирования временных интервалов опр едепяется сигналом Старт", который поступает одновременно на все триггеры сдвигового регист ра. Окончание интервала, формируемого первым триггером, соответствует моменту поступления первого стопового сигнала, окончание интервала, формируемого вторым триггербм, — второму стоповому сигналу и т. д. 2 .

Недостаток этого преобразователя— погрешность измерений различна дпя каждого временного интервала и зависит

85599

10!

25

35

45

55,пз только оТ вероятностного распределеL ния стоповых сигналов, но и от распределения задержки в каналах формирования и распределения временных интервалов.

Пель изобретения — повышение точности преобразования путем увеличения числа каналов формирования и распределения временных интервалов и статистического усреднения задержек в них при случайном распределении и ограниченном числе стоповых сигналов.

Поставленная цель достигается тем, что в многостоповый преобразователь временных интервалов в цифровой код, содержащий и счетчиков, сдвиговый регистр, и логических элементов И, генератор тактовых импульсов и таймер, и выходов сдвигового регистра соединены с первыми входами соответствующих логических элементов И, другие входы которых объединены между собой и соединены с выходом генератора тактовых импульсов, дополнительно введены (и + 1) входовых мажоритарных элементов, распределитель, (н — 1) сдвиговый регистр, (1п — 1) н логических элементов И и птп входовых логических элементов ИЛИ, причем выход таймера соединен с синхрониэируюшим входом распределителя, каждые П выходов которого соединены соответственно с и входами соответствующего мажоритарного элемента и информационными входами соответствующего сдвигового регистра, управляющие входы мажоритарных элементов объединены между собой и соедийены со входом таймера и первым входом преобразователя, выходы мажоритарных элементов подключены ко входам установки в единичное состояние соответствующих сдвиговых регистров, синхронизирующие входы которых объединены между собой и соединены со вторым входом преобразователя, каждые и выходов дополнительных сдвиговых регистров соединены соответственно с первыми входами дополнительных логических элементов И, вторые входы которых объединены и соединены с выходом генератора тактовых импульсов, 1 -ые выходы всех элементов И через 1 -ый логический элемент ИЛИ соединены с синхрониэирующим входом 1 -го счетчика.

На фиг. 1 представлен многостоповый преобразователь временных интервалов в цифровой код на фиг. 2 - прафики, иллюстрирующие процесс получения усредненного результата измерения одного временного интервала; на фиг.3

6 4 с хема кольцевого сдвигового регистра с и информационными входами.

Преобразователь состоит из таймера

1, распределителя 2 с vn-n выходами, . генератора 3 тактовых импульсов, m мажоритарных элементов 4„ совпаде.. ний на два с (и+ 1) входами сдвиговых регистров 5,п с и выходами, каждый из которых имеет п информационных входов и выполнен по кольцевой схеме, rn.п логических элементов 6. уп

И с двумя входами, п логических эле:ментов 74 и ИЛИ с rn входами. и п счетчиков 8 q-n . Выход таймера 1 соединен с сипхрониэирующим входом р аспределителя 2, первые и выходов которого соединены соответственно с и . входами первого мажоритарного элемента

4 совпадений и инФормационными входами первого сдвигового регистра 5, вход установки в единичное состояние которого соединен с выходом данного мажоритарного элемента, первые выходы и логических элементов И 6 через п логических элементов ИЛИ 7< > соединены соответственно с синхрониэируюппь и входами счетчиков 8„,.п, вторые и выходов распределителя 2 соединены соответственно с и входами второго сдвигового регистра 5„вход установки в единичное состояние которого соединен с выходом данного мажоритарного элемента, - и выходов второго сдвигового регистра 5 g соединены соответственно с первыми входами вторых и логических элементов И 60, выход каждого из которых через и соответствующих логических элементов ИЛИ 7„соединены с синхрониэирующими входами соответствующих счетчиков B„n и т. д, до m-ых г1 выходов распределителя 2

Управляющие входы мажоритарных эле ментов 2 п1 объединены между собой и соединены с входом таймера 1 и входом

Старт" преобразователя, синхронизирующие входы сдвиговых регистров 5 объединены между собой и .соединены со входом "Стоп" преобразователя, вторые входы логических элементов И 6 1 объединены между собой и соединены с выходом генератора 3 тактовых импульсовв.

Кольцевой сдвиговый регистр состоит из и триггеров 9 и и логических элементов 1Î ИЛИ, причем синхронизирующие входы и входы установки в нулевое состояние всех триггеров соответственно объединены между собой, выход каждого предыдущего триггера соеди855 « нен с одним из входов элемента 10 ИЛИ, выход которого соединен с информационным входом,поспедуюшего триггер а.

Преобр азов атепь работает следующим образом.

В исходном.состоянии на одном из

«т - выходов распределитепя 2, например, на одном из первых выходов, имеется логический О, поступающий на один из и входов первого мажоритарного элемента 4 и на один из и информационных входов первого сдв игового регистра 5 . По сигнапу

Старт с выхода мажоритарного эпемента 4„происходит .установка всех и триггеров сдвигового регистра 5- в единичное состояние и запуск тайме ра 1, опредепяющего время цикпа работы преобразователя. При установке триггеров первого сдвигового регистра 5 в единичное состояние импульсы тако†вого генератора 3 через первые и элементов 6 совпадений и все элементы

ИЛИ 7+„,поступают на синхронизирующие входы всех счетчиков 8,1 > . По первому сигналу "Стоп" происходит сброс в нулевое состояние триггера первого сдвигзвого регистра 5„, íà информационном входе которого был логический

"О, поступающий с одного иэ первых выходов распредепителя 2. При этом синхронизирующий вход одного из и счетчиков 8 закрывается и счет импульсов с тактового генератора 3 данным счет чиком прекращается. Одновременно с этим триггер первого сдвигового регистра 5., установленный в нулевое состояние первым cTotloBbIM сигналом, вырабатывает разрешение для следующего триггера, установка в нулевое состояние которого происходит по второму сигналу "Стоп".

Таким образом, еспи в исходном состоянии логический "О" с первых из q выходов распределителя 2 поступает на информационный вход первого триггера первого сдвигового регистра 5„, то при поступлении н стоповых сигналов все триггеры первого сдвигового регистра 5 устанавливаются в нулевое состояние и на всех счетчиках Р „ прекращается счет.

При окончании работы таймера 1 происходит сдвиг на единицу логического О на выходе распредепитепя 2. По второму сигналу Старт процесс работы повторяется, отличаясь только тем,что теперь первый временной интервал формируется следующим триггером первого роятностью Я, . Я,„, когда цикл изме1 рения начат с триггера при отсутствии первого стопового сигнала, либо с веро50 ятностью Q ° g, когда цикл измерения начат с (к-1)-го триггера при первом стоповом сигнале . Тогда, гЪ

1 + 3 L с вероятностью

% Я. Я = a

Третий временной интервал будет сформирован триггером с вероятностью < когда цикл измерения начат с триггера. при отсутствии первого и второго

45 сдвигового регистра и измерен соответственно следующим счетчиком по отно шению к триггеру и счетчику, которыми был сформирован и измерен временной интервал в первом цикле измерениял. Последний п -ый триггер первого сдвигового регистра в этом спучае при установке . в нулевое состояние по (n — 1)-му стоповому сигналу вырабатывает разрешение для первого триггера, установка в нупевое состояние которого происходит по и — му стоповому сигнапу

П ри поступлении (tl + 1 ) сигнала

"Старт" с выхода второго мажоритарного элемента совпадений 2 происходит установка в единичное состояние второго сдвигового регистра 5 . При этом дпя всех следующих и сигналов " Старт" формирование и распределение времен» ных пнторвапов осуществляется триггерами второго сдвигового регистра 5 и т.. д.

Покажем на примере работы одного сдвигового регистра, что вероятность формирования любого временного интервала каждым триггером данного сдвигового регистра не зависит в этом случае от вероятностного распределения стоповых сигналов.

Пусть вероятность появления первого стопового сигнала Я, второго

c третьего —,, ... л — ro — g

Причем « 1 1 «1,, ) $g 1- lj. ...« „== 1 — „, 11оскопьку вероятность формирования первого временного интервала не зави сит от вероятностного распределения других стоповых сигналов, то при копьцевой выборке распределителем триггеров сдвигового регистра первый временной интервал формируется каждым триггером с вероятностью Q<, т.е. для каждого триггера будет справедливо

55 ь х с вероятностью Я„

Второй временной интервал будет сформирован каждым триггером с вестоповых сигналов; с вероятностью

Q O „с + Я q, Я„, когда цикл измерения начат с (к- 1)-го триггера при отсутствии первого и второго стоповых сигналов либо с вероятностью с),„с, когда цикл измерения начат с (к-2)-ro триггера при первом и втором стоповых сигнал ах.

Тогда kg+ 5ñ с вероятностью

% Я 9 + 4 Ч-Яа+Ч З ЪД,+ 1ч 11% =- ЧЗ

Аналогичным образом можно получить, что вероятности формирования временных интервалов +4, ... каждым триггером будут равны соответственно ! 4 » ° » п °

Таким образом, при кольцевой выборке распределителем триггеров сдвигового регистра вероятность формирования каждым триГГером данноГо сдвиговОГО ре» гистра не зависит от вероятностного распределения стоповых сигналов.

Поскольку . каждый временной ин тервал формируется всеми триггерами данного сдвигового регистра, то при случайном распределении задержки в каналах формирования и распределения стоповых сигналов, результат измерения каждого временного интервала будет иметь также случайное распределение, обусловленное распределением задержки.

При ограниченном числе стоповых сигналов в предлагаемом преобразователе эффект статистического усреднения достигается тем, что в нем число каналов формирования и распределения временных интервалов равно произведению щ и

Таким образом, предлагаемый многостоповый преобразователь временных интервалов в цифровой код облвдает перед известным преобразователем рядом преимуществ: в нем исключена завис мость вероятности формирования любого временного интервала каждым триггером сдвигового регистра и реализовано статистическое усреднение задержек в каналах формирования и распределения временных интервалов при ограниченном числе стоповых сигналов, что уменьшает искажение исследуемого временного спект— ра

Формул а изобр етения

Многостоповый преобразователь временных интервалов в цифровой код, содер5М6 & жащий и ссччееттччииккоовв, сдвиговый регистр, логических элементов И, генератор тактовых импульсов и таймер, л выходов сдвигoBoFo регистра соединены с пер выми входами соответствующих логических элементов И, другие входы которых объединены между собой и соединены с выходом генератора тактовых импульсов, отличающийся тем, что, с це1О лью повыш ения точ ности преобр азова ния в него дополнительно введены m (и <-1) входовых мажоритарных элементов, распределитель, (rn-Õ) сдвиговый регистр, (rn-1)

6 логических элементов И и rt гп входовых логических элементов ИЛИ, причем выход таймера соединен с синхронизирующИм входом распределителя, каждые р выходов которого соединены соответственно с п входами соответствующего мажоритарного элемента и информационными входами соответствующего сдвигового регистра, управляющие входы мажоритар- . ных элементов объединены между собой и соединены со входом таймера и первым входом преобразователя, выходы мажоритарных элементов подключены ко входам установки в единичное состояние соответствующих сдвиговых регистров, синхронизирующие входы которых объединены между собой и соединены со вторым входом преобразователя, каждые выходов дополнительных сдвиговых регистров соединены соответственно с первыми входами дополнительных логических элементов И, вторые входы кото35 рых объединены и соединены с выходом генератора тактовых импульсов, i -ые выходы всех элементов И через j -ый логический элемент ИЛИ соединены c . .синхронизирующим входом 1 -ro счетчи40 ка, Источники информации, принятые во внимание при экспертизе

1.Lomb СЪаппе1 Т п е Апс йу е М

УДГ4ЦЫЕ Ctpnne2 ид=П Я5З, Sb Ф 4, 11 61-1164, 1965

2. Многостоповый конвертер с непосредственным преобразованием времени в код. hued.3 )81гvm . anal т91И.

140 ¹ 2, 283-287., 1977.

855996

ЧИСЛО

ОТСЧ В70В

РЕрЬЬ Й КАЙМА

ФОРМИР© 5>HHQ

8РЕы Еи ЙОГО

ИНТЕРЬАМ

ЯТОРОД KAHAAТ

ТР9ТИЙ KAHAh1

М(Т8ЯРТЫЙ @AHA@

0%Ть4 кАнм

ШЕСТОЙ КАНМ

ФИГ. 2. ЩРЕД(фМЙЫИ

ИЗМЕРЕНИР

ОДйСГО ф М ИНОГО HHTKPSAAA.